Thrives on taking life’s hard knocks on 90210

The Vancouver native has seen her character Adrianna on CW’s “90210” (Tuesday night at 8 on WLVI [website], Ch. 56) through a drug addiction, an HIV scare and now an unexpected pregnancy. She has a horrific mom and a boyfriend who is unhappy she’s carrying another man’s child.

“Adrianna is constantly searching for that happy ending and it’s nowhere in sight. It’s emotionally draining because my eyes are puffy every day of my life, but it’s so rewarding. When I see the finished product, I’m very proud of it,” Lowndes said.

Tuesday night, Adrianna tells Ty (Adam Gregory) that she’s pregnant with his baby.

“My character is going to go through with the pregnancy, and it’s a real strengthening of responsibility for her. And even though she did have a drug habit and did a lot of horrible things, she is a really responsible character. I think she will be able to do this.”

When Lowndes was signed to appear on the show, all she knew about her character was that she was going to be the girl singing in the school musical.

“I didn’t know about a drug habit. I didn’t know about any of it. I was so surprised when I kept getting a script and I was in it. I was just thrilled and excited. To be given such amazing material that they deal with in such a real and honest way, I felt really fortunate.”

The 20-year-old, who was promoted to series regular midway through the season, was shopping with her mom in Vancouver and spontaneously decided to go into an open audition for a movie. She didn’t get a part, but she landed an agent and that soon led to a move to Los Angeles and a guest role on “Greek.”

Now she can’t go to a mall without being recognized.

“Some girls come up to me and say, ‘I can totally relate to what you go through with your mother on this show,’ ” she said. “It’s really hard, but I’m at least there for them and they can relate to my character and not feel so alone in their situation, and that’s the best thing I can do. It’s kind of fun and amazing because I love that I’m able to affect people.”

She’s had many scenes with Shannen Doherty and Jennie Garth, who reprise their characters from the original series.

“I pinch myself every time I’m in a scene with them. They’re the reason for ‘90210’ and for the original fan base. Shannen is such a giving actress, and when she’s not on camera, she’s still crying, she’s still in that scene. She’s giving you as much as possible, and that’s the best gift an actor can give you.”
